PR to Merge Multicore OCaml
1. Domains are the unit of parallelism. A domain is essentially an OS thread with a bunch of extra runtime book-keeping data. You can use Domain.spawn (https://github.com/ocaml-multicore/ocaml-multicore/blob/5.00...) to spawn off a new domain which will run the supplied function and terminate when it finishes. This is heavyweight though, domains are expected to be long-running.
2. Domainslib is the library developed alongside multicore to aid users in exploiting parallelism. It supports nested parallelism and is pretty highly optimised (https://github.com/ocaml-multicore/domainslib/pull/29 for some graphs/numbers). The domainslib repo has some good examples: https://github.com/ocaml-multicore/domainslib/tree/master/te...
3. We've not tested against other forms of parallelism. There isn't anything stopping you exploiting SIMD in addition to parallelism from domains.
4. No, we've not compared performance by OS.
5. No plans for the multicore team to look at accelerator integration at the moment.

Graydon Hoare: What's next for language design? (2017)
Until recently Multicore OCaml was focused on deep handlers. The people working on the formalization of effects (either for program proofs or typed effects) were quite keen to have shallow handler integrated however. Thus, the effect module of the OCaml 5 preview contains both (see https://github.com/ocaml-multicore/ocaml-multicore/blob/5.00...) since September. I fear that non-academic literature has not followed this change (on the academic side, see https://dl.acm.org/doi/10.1145/3434314 for a program proofs point of view).

ReScript: Rust like features for JavaScript
ReScript is "Fast, Simple, Fully Typed JavaScript from the Future". What that means is that ReScript has a lightning fast compiler, an easy to learn JS like syntax, strong static types, with amazing features like pattern matching and variant types. Until 2020 it was called "BuckleScript" and is closely related to ReasonML.

Building React Components Using Unions in TypeScript
This is because a “Tagged Union”, another word for TypeScript’s Discriminated Union, is a way to “tag which one is in use right now… we check the tag to see”. Just like when you’re shopping and check the tag of a piece of clothing to see what the price is, what size it is, or what material it’s made out of. Languages like ReScript compile many of their Unions (called Variants) to JavaScript Objects that have a tag property.
